Re: [patch 00/04] RFC: Staging tree (drivers/staging)
From: Greg KH
Date: Fri Sep 26 2008 - 16:33:19 EST
On Fri, Sep 26, 2008 at 04:11:49PM -0400, Parag Warudkar wrote:
> On Fri, Sep 26, 2008 at 2:36 PM, Stefan Richter
> <stefanr@xxxxxxxxxxxxxxxxx> wrote:
> > It _is_ necessary. I for one don't want to have to remember that driver
> > foobar was in "staging" state in kernel 2.6.31-rc5, but not anymore in
> > 2.6.32-rc1.
>
> Just name the staging modules with _stg prefix like I said - easier to
> spot _stg in the module list than decoding the taint.
Um, it's the same, the taint is decoded automatically for you, no need
to strain any brain cells trying to figure it out :)
If people really want a prefix, sure, I have no objection, that's simple
to add.
> Whenever (doubtful tone here) it graduates, remove the suffix.
5 drivers "graduated" last release cycle, so it will happen.
> Driver modules load automatically any way so the name change is not
> going to make a difference.
Agreed.
> It is nice to not have to change core kernel code and annoy users with
> warnings for the staging crap even if it is just 24 lines or whatever
> - if we can - and I don't see why we cannot. Staging, just like
> crapping, has to be a totally isolated, zero side effect, zero
> annoyance (to others) type thing :) So let's please get rid of that
> taint and warning already :)
No, that was one of the requirements that came out of the discussions at
the kernel summit, I'm going to leave both the warning and the modalias
and taint flag there, sorry.
If you really don't like it, just never enable any of these modules,
you'll never be bothered by it.
thanks,
greg k-h
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/